Aký je používateľský limit v systéme Linux?

Ulimit (user limit) je výkonný príkaz, ktorý pomáha obmedziť zdroje vo vašom systéme. Niekedy, ale nie veľmi často, môže jeden používateľ spustiť príliš veľa procesov, aby bol systém nestabilný. Aby sme to zmiernili, môžeme použiť príkaz ulimit na obmedzenie počtu procesov, ktoré môže spustiť každý používateľ alebo skupina.

Čo je to Max užívateľské procesy Linux?

do /etc/sysctl. conf. 4194303 je maximálny limit pre x86_64 a 32767 pre x86. Krátka odpoveď na vašu otázku: Počet možných procesov v systéme linux je NEOBMEDZENÝ.

Na čo sa Ulimit používa?

ulimit je príkaz prostredia Linux, ktorý vyžaduje prístup správcu, ktorý sa používa na zobrazenie, nastavenie alebo obmedzenie využívania zdrojov aktuálneho používateľa. Používa sa na vrátenie počtu otvorených deskriptorov súborov pre každý proces. Používa sa tiež na nastavenie obmedzení zdrojov používaných procesom.

Ako zvýšim maximálny počet používateľských procesov?

Ako obmedziť proces na úrovni používateľa v systéme Linux

  1. Skontrolujte všetky aktuálne limity. Môžete skontrolovať všetky limity pre aktuálne prihláseného používateľa. …
  2. Nastaviť ulimit pre používateľa. Môžete použiť ulimit -u na nájdenie maximálneho počtu používateľských procesov alebo limitu nproc. …
  3. Nastavte Ulimit pre otvorený súbor. Na zobrazenie limitov otvorených súborov pre každého používateľa môžeme použiť príkaz ulimit. …
  4. Nastavte limit používateľa cez systemd. …
  5. Záver.

6 rokov. 2018 г.

Je Ulimit užívateľom?

Ulimit je limit na proces, nie na reláciu alebo používateľa, ale môžete obmedziť, koľko používateľov procesu môže spustiť. Ďakujem za Vašu odpoveď. riadiť svoje úlohy. Súhlasím však s vaším tvrdením, že ulimit sú limity na proces.

Koľko procesov môže bežať na Linuxe?

Áno, viaceré procesy môžu bežať súčasne (bez prepínania kontextu) vo viacjadrových procesoroch. Ak sú všetky procesy jednovláknové, ako sa pýtate, v dvojjadrovom procesore môžu súčasne bežať 2 procesy.

Ako natrvalo nastavím Ulimit v systéme Linux?

Ak chcete nastaviť alebo overiť hodnoty ulimit v systéme Linux:

  1. Prihláste sa ako používateľ root.
  2. Upravte súbor /etc/security/limits.conf a zadajte nasledujúce hodnoty: admin_user_ID soft nofile 32768. admin_user_ID hard nofile 65536. …
  3. Prihláste sa ako admin_user_ID .
  4. Reštartujte systém: esadmin system stopall. spustenie systému esadmin.

Čo znamená Ulimit?

Ulimit je počet otvorených deskriptorov súborov na proces. Je to metóda na obmedzenie počtu rôznych zdrojov, ktoré môže proces spotrebovať.

Ako skontrolujete Ulimit?

príkaz ulimit:

  1. ulimit -n –> Zobrazí limit počtu otvorených súborov.
  2. ulimit -c –> Zobrazí veľkosť súboru jadra.
  3. umilit -u –> Zobrazí maximálny limit používateľských procesov pre prihláseného používateľa.
  4. ulimit -f –> Zobrazí maximálnu veľkosť súboru, ktorú môže mať používateľ.

9 hodín. 2019 г.

Ako zobrazím otvorené limity v systéme Linux?

nájsť limit otvorených súborov na proces: ulimit -n. spočítať všetky otvorené súbory všetkými procesmi: lsof | wc -l. získajte maximálny povolený počet otvorených súborov: cat /proc/sys/fs/file-max.

Čo sú Max používateľské procesy v Ulimit?

Dočasne nastaviť maximálny počet používateľských procesov

Táto metóda dočasne zmení limit cieľového používateľa. Ak používateľ reštartuje reláciu alebo sa reštartuje systém, limit sa obnoví na predvolenú hodnotu. Ulimit je vstavaný nástroj, ktorý sa používa na túto úlohu.

Ako upravíte Ulimit?

  1. Ak chcete zmeniť nastavenie ulimit, upravte súbor /etc/security/limits.conf a nastavte v ňom tvrdé a mäkké limity: …
  2. Teraz otestujte nastavenia systému pomocou nasledujúcich príkazov: …
  3. Ak chcete skontrolovať aktuálny limit otvoreného deskriptora súboru: …
  4. Ak chcete zistiť, koľko deskriptorov súborov sa momentálne používa:

Čo je Max uzamknutá pamäť?

max locked memory (kbytes, -l) Maximálna veľkosť, ktorá môže byť uzamknutá v pamäti. Zamykanie pamäte zaisťuje, že pamäť je vždy v RAM a nikdy sa nepresunie na odkladací disk.

Čo sú bezpečnostné limity ETC conf?

/etc/security/limits. conf umožňuje nastaviť limity zdrojov pre používateľov prihlásených cez PAM. Je to užitočný spôsob, ako zabrániť, aby napríklad vidlicové bomby spotrebovali všetky systémové zdroje. Poznámka: Súbor neovplyvňuje systémové služby.

Čo je hodnota Nproc Linux?

nproc nie je nič iné ako počet otvorených procesov v systéme. Hodnota nproc je tá, ktorá riadi užívateľský prah, koľko otvorených procesov môže užívateľ v systéme otvoriť. V nižšie uvedenom príklade môže používateľ Paul otvoriť 1024 otvorených procesov v systéme.

Ako zmením používateľské procesy Ulimit max v systéme Linux?

Ako obmedziť proces na úrovni používateľa v systéme Linux

  1. Skontrolujte všetky aktuálne limity. Môžete skontrolovať všetky limity pre aktuálne prihláseného používateľa. …
  2. Nastaviť ulimit pre používateľa. Môžete použiť ulimit -u na nájdenie maximálneho počtu používateľských procesov alebo limitu nproc. …
  3. Nastavte Ulimit pre otvorený súbor. Na zobrazenie limitov otvorených súborov pre každého používateľa môžeme použiť príkaz ulimit. …
  4. Nastavte limit používateľa cez systemd. …
  5. Záver.

6 rokov. 2018 г.

Páči sa vám tento príspevok? Zdieľajte prosím so svojimi priateľmi:
OS dnes